Back before the game got delayed the first time 343 stated that RTX would not be live at launch of the game because it wasn’t ready, now that the game has had a full year delay there has been no word on this feature, it would be nice to know if RTX is ready for launch of Infinite? Would be really nice for a first time experience to have as many graphical options as possible and RTX on an open world Halo ring would be amazing!
Yeah, that would be nice to know RTX will just give infinite that extra cherry on top.
I think the safe assumption is that no, it will not be available at launch, simply because they haven’t mentioned that it will be. But who knows, it definitely could have made it on board for launch by now.
RTX will definitely not be there at launch. It will probably take a year or more for Ray tracing to be added to the game if it is at all. It’ll probably follow the same path as Doom Eternal which got ray tracing about a year after it initially launched.

The FPS drop actually doesn’t always apply depending on how well the game is optimized for it, in MW2019 I can have all settings fully maxed with RTX on and upscale the game to 8k and still get over 100fps while in Cold War if I turn RTX on it drops me below 50fps on low settings. Game optimization is key for RTX to perform well.
